    Why Satan/The Devil isn't actually in the Hebrew Old Testament [VIDEO]

    Yes the serpent in the Garden is not the same as "the accuser" in the book of Job. "the accuser" works for God. The serpent doesn't work for God and serpents in the Ancient world did have negative connotations, hence a snake also being the foil in Gilgamesh.

    Why Satan/The Devil isn't actually in the Hebrew Old Testament [VIDEO]

    In the NT Satan is described as a "ruler of this world" and a prince of demons who has a kingdom of his own that works against God's kingdom. In the Hebrew Bible (at least before the Book of Enoch) "the satan" actually worked FOR God, doing the job God gave them. Similar to "the destroyer" in...
